| Sporting the headdress of a Japanese dragon, Jalen Thompson-Johnson, 6, leads his first-grade class down the hallways of Club Boulevard Humanities Magnet School during a parade celebrating the Japanese New Year. Following the Gregorian calendar, the new year actually begins on the first of January, but this was a special celebration to end a month of hands-on activities and lessons that focused on Japan and its culture. Next stop on the map: Kenya. |
